Types of Exercise Bikes
Stationary bicycle can be found in different styles, each designed to accommodate various fitness needs and choices. Here are the main types:
Type of Exercise BikeDescriptionBest ForUpright BikesFeature a standard cycling position and adjustable seatsGeneral fitness and endurance trainingRecumbent BikesHave a reclined seat position that offers back supportThose with back problems or recuperating from injurySpin BikesTough bikes for high-intensity period training (HIIT) and spin classesSpin lovers and extreme exercisesAir BikesUtilize a fan to supply resistance and intensity based on user effortAdvanced fitness instructors and strength building exercisesBenefits of Using an Exercise Bike1. Cardiovascular Fitness
Stationary bicycle provide an exceptional cardiovascular exercise. They assist enhance the heart and lungs, boost endurance, and enhance overall fitness.
2. Low Impact
Cycling is a low-impact exercise, minimizing tension on the joints. This makes exercise bikes suitable for people with joint concerns or those fixing up from injuries.
3. Weight Management
Regular use of stationary bicycle promotes calorie burning, which can help in weight-loss or maintenance when combined with a well balanced diet plan.
4. Convenience
Stationary bicycle can be used in your home, removing travel time to the gym. This convenience causes more consistent exercises.
5. Adjustable Resistance
Numerous stationary bicycle include adjustable resistance levels, enabling users to customize their exercises to their personal fitness levels and goals.
Secret Features to Consider When Buying an Exercise Bike
When acquiring an exercise bike, it's vital to consider several functions to guarantee the best suitable for your needs:
1. ConvenienceSeat Cushioning: Look for a cushioned seat for included comfort during long workouts.Adjustable Seat Height: An adjustable seat ensures correct alignment and prevents pain.2. Resistance LevelsTypes of Resistance: Bikes may feature magnetic, friction, or air resistance. Choose one based upon your preference for smoothness and noise level.Number of Levels: More levels provide greater versatility in your workout.3. Show ConsoleFunctions like heart rate monitoring, range tracking, and workout programs can enhance motivation and supply valuable workout information.4. Size and PortabilityConsider the dimensions and weight of the bike, especially if area is restricted. Search for choices with transportation wheels for easy motion.5. Additional FeaturesBluetooth Connectivity: Some bikes use connection to apps that track fitness metrics or supply directed workouts.Built-in Speakers: For those who take pleasure in music, built-in speakers can improve the exercise experience.Popular Exercise Bike Models

How typically should I utilize a stationary bicycle?
For ideal results, go for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ic exercise or 75 minutes of energetic exercise per week, which can be broken down into manageable sessions.
2. Can I lose weight using an exercise bike?
Yes, biking can help burn calories and assistance weight reduction when accompanied by a well balanced diet plan. The rate of weight reduction depends upon strength, period, and frequency of exercises.
3. Is it safe for seniors to use exercise bikes?
Definitely! Exercise bikes provide a low-impact option that is gentle on the joints, making them suitable for seniors. However, consultation with a healthcare provider for customized recommendations is recommended.
4. Do I need to wear special shoes for cycling?
While you can use routine athletic shoes, some bikes come with SPD-compatible pedals, which are developed for biking shoes that clip into the pedals for enhanced stability and efficiency.
